This position reports directly to the Lab Shared Services System Operations Director and has responsibility to the CSS Laboratory Operations Officer, Intermountain Laboratory Shared Services and Facility Administrator. The Lab Manger works in partnership with other facility management and departments to ensure the provision of optimal patient care, attainment of financial goals, and development of caregivers. Responsible for providing high quality, standardized laboratory practices, and cost-efficient support by the laboratory. The leader will have direct accountability for the operation, function, and staffing of facilities within Laboratory Shared Services for community hospital, high-complexity laboratory and department(s). Must have a minimum of two of these targets to include: a facility with greater than 19 beds, inpatient revenue 110-599M and span of control 12-75. Essential Functions Communicates with CSS leader for most questions and issues and ensures awareness, alignment, and collaboration with the care site dotted line administrative leader. Manages the operations at the laboratory, communicating care site and laboratory services goals and initiatives. Ensures implementation of standardized processes. Develops capital and operations budgets in partnership with the Lab System Operations Director and Finance Analyst and accountable to successfully manage laboratory resources and assets. Responsible for service line performance and compliance with safety initiatives, federal, state and other regulatory bodies including but not limited to CLIA, CAP, JC, OSHA, CMS, and other department specific accrediting and certifying bodies. Assists supervisor(s) in human resource functions including sufficient staffing, hiring, orientation, appropriate training, annual competency assessment of caregivers and performance management. Promotes the use of continuous improvement philosophies to ensure the delivery of quality care. Utilizes available engagement metrics and national benchmarks to achieve desired outcomes in patient experience. Creates and models a culture where caregivers are professional, engaged, valued and recognized. Rounds regularly on laboratory caregivers. Maintains selected bench competency and skills.
